問題
一、執行svn commit時候,會生成除正常檔案之外.mine、.r3439 、.r3368的三個檔案
.mine:是自己要提交的版本
.r3439:在別人之前提交的版本
.r3368:初始版本
解決:檢視歷史記錄,檢視之前提交的人修改過什麼地方
然後手動把修改的地方合併到出正常檔案裡面,然後刪除三個衝突檔案,然後再提交
問題2:提示需要clear up 但是執行的時候失敗
可能因為前一次的失敗,到此本次的查詢進入了死迴圈
2、在cmd進入
對應需要clear up的資料夾
執行**如下:
sqlite3 .svn/wc.db "select * from work_queue"sqlite3 .svn/wc.db "delete from work_queue"
3、再次繼續執行 clear up 操作;
svn衝突解決
by lone on june 21,2011 1 如何產生衝突 當開發人員a和開發人員b從版本庫同時檢出文件1.txt,而a和b同時修改了1.txt的同一地方,後提交的一方會在拷貝副本中產生衝突。兩個工作拷貝,a拷貝中檔案1.txt內容為 dfqerq 123dfwre b拷貝中檔案1.txt內容...
svn解決衝突
2個使用者修改了同乙個原始檔,a使用者先提交 然後b使用者提交 這個時候就出現衝突了。出現衝突之後,b使用者這邊出現了4個檔案 1個是原始檔本身 3個附加的原始檔 1.原始檔本身的意思是指,該檔案在解決衝突之後可以被提交。這個檔案裡面包含了本地的檔案,加上自己修改的 加上別人修改的 除此之外,還有小...
SVN 衝突解決
版本衝突原因 假設a b兩個使用者都在版本號為100的時候,更新了kingtuns.txt這個檔案,a使用者在修改完成之後提交kingtuns.txt到伺服器,這個時候提交成功,這個時候kingtuns.txt檔案的版本號已經變成101了。同時b使用者在版本號為100的kingtuns.txt檔案上...